SQL COUNT() Funktion

SQL COUNT() funktionen er en meget nyttig og kraftfuld funktion inden for SQL (Structured Query Language). Den bruges til at tælle antallet af rækker eller poster i en database tabel. Denne funktion kan være afgørende, når det kommer til at analysere og behandle data effektivt i en database.

Hvordan virker SQL COUNT() Funktionen?

SQL COUNT() funktionen opererer på en eller flere kolonner i en tabel og returnerer antallet af rækker, der opfylder den angivne betingelse. Det kan også bruges uden en WHERE-klausul for at tælle totalt antal rækker i en tabel. Her er et eksempel på syntaxen:

SELECT COUNT(column_name) FROM table_name WHERE condition;

Denne query vil tælle antallet af rækker i en tabel baseret på den angivne betingelse. Hvis du udelader WHERE-klausulen, vil den simpelthen tælle alle rækker i tabellen.

Eksempel på SQL COUNT() Funktionen

Lad os antage, at vi har en tabel kaldet employees med kolonner som employee_id, name og department_id. Hvis vi vil tælle antallet af medarbejdere i en bestemt afdeling, kan vi bruge følgende SQL-forespørgsel:

SELECT COUNT(employee_id) FROM employees WHERE department_id = 1;

Dette vil give os antallet af medarbejdere i afdelingen med ID 1. Vi kan også bruge COUNT() funktionen uden en betingelse for at finde ud af det totale antal medarbejdere i tabellen.

Sammenfatning

SQL COUNT() funktionen er en afgørende ressource, når det kommer til at arbejde med store mængder data i en database. Ved at bruge COUNT() kan du nemt tælle antallet af rækker, der opfylder en bestemt betingelse, samt det totale antal rækker i en tabel. Dette kan være til stor hjælp ved datamanipulation og analyse i SQL-databaser.

Hvad er formålet med SQL COUNT() funktionen?

SQL COUNT() funktionen bruges til at tælle antallet af rækker, der opfylder en bestemt betingelse i en database tabel. Den returnerer et numerisk resultat, der angiver antallet af rækker, der opfylder betingelsen.

Hvordan bruges COUNT() funktionen i en SQL forespørgsel?

COUNT() funktionen bruges normalt i forbindelse med SELECT-udtrykket i en SQL forespørgsel. Syntaxen er som følger: SELECT COUNT(column_name) FROM table_name WHERE condition; Dette vil returnere antallet af rækker, der opfylder betingelsen angivet i WHERE-klausulen.

Kan COUNT() funktionen bruges uden en WHERE-klausul?

Ja, COUNT() funktionen kan også bruges uden en WHERE-klausul. I dette tilfælde vil den tælle antallet af rækker i den angivne kolonne i hele tabellen.

Hvordan kan resultaterne fra COUNT() funktionen sorteres i stigende rækkefølge?

Resultaterne fra COUNT() funktionen kan sorteres i stigende rækkefølge ved at tilføje ORDER BY COUNT(column_name) ASC til SQL-forespørgslen.

Hvordan kan man filtrere resultaterne af COUNT() funktionen yderligere?

Resultaterne af COUNT() funktionen kan yderligere filtreres ved at tilføje en GROUP BY-klausul til SQL-forespørgslen. Dette vil gruppere resultaterne baseret på den specificerede kolonne og returnere antallet af rækker i hver gruppe.

Kan COUNT() funktionen bruges sammen med andre SQL-aggregatfunktioner?

Ja, COUNT() funktionen kan bruges sammen med andre SQL-aggregatfunktioner som SUM, AVG, MIN og MAX for at udføre forskellige beregninger på data i en database tabel.

Hvordan kan man tælle antallet af unikke værdier i en kolonne ved hjælp af COUNT() funktionen?

For at tælle antallet af unikke værdier i en kolonne, kan man bruge COUNT DISTINCT(column_name) i stedet for COUNT(column_name) i SQL-forespørgslen.

Hvad er forskellen mellem COUNT(*) og COUNT(column_name) i SQL?

COUNT(*) returnerer antallet af rækker i en tabel, uanset om der er NULL-værdier i kolonnen, mens COUNT(column_name) returnerer antallet af rækker, hvor den specificerede kolonne ikke har en NULL-værdi.

Hvordan kan man implementere betingelser i COUNT() funktionen?

Betingelser kan implementeres i COUNT() funktionen ved at tilføje en WHERE-klausul til SQL-forespørgslen. Dette gør det muligt at tælle antallet af rækker, der opfylder den angivne betingelse.

Hvilke andre SQL-funktioner kan bruges til at forbedre resultaterne fra COUNT() funktionen?

Ud over COUNT() funktionen kan andre SQL-funktioner som IF, CASE og COALESCE bruges til at manipulere og forbedre resultaterne fra COUNT() funktionen baseret på forskellige betingelser og scenarier.

Sådan styler du HR-elementet med CSSHow To – Overgangseffekter ved hover i CSSNode.js Email: Effektivt og Fleksibelt KommunikationsværktøjC Data Types: En dybdegående guidePHP Array Functions – En dybdegående guideHTML Citations ElementerPython break Keyword: En dybdegående undersøgelse af dets funktion og anvendelsePython open() FunktionEn dybdegående guide til PHP CookiesW3.CSS Images